Output ec32a9331361467aed06eccfeeb68ce309b6f2ad1d20fd130baead5017a5d5c6:3

value
1004080
script pubkey
OP_0 OP_PUSHBYTES_20 f693b06e316138c2482eeaea4f20d71e7987e392
address
bc1q76fmqm33vyuvyjpwat4y7gxhreuc0cujl8g86k
transaction
ec32a9331361467aed06eccfeeb68ce309b6f2ad1d20fd130baead5017a5d5c6
spent
true